1. The Sink: The Ubiquitous Hub of Activity

The sink is arguably the most versatile and frequently used plumbing fixture in any home. From washing hands to rinsing dishes, preparing food to cleaning up spills, the sink is at the center of countless daily activities. It’s a basin designed to hold water and typically equipped with a faucet for water supply and a drain for wastewater removal.

Types of Sinks: Beyond the Basic Basin

The humble sink has evolved significantly, offering a diverse range of styles and materials to suit different needs and aesthetics.

  • Kitchen Sinks: These are generally larger and deeper than bathroom sinks, designed for heavy-duty use in food preparation and dishwashing. They come in various configurations, including:

    • Single-bowl sinks: Offering a large, uninterrupted space for washing pots and pans.
    • Double-bowl sinks: Allowing for simultaneous washing and rinsing, or separation of dirty dishes from clean ones.
    • Farmhouse sinks (Apron-front sinks): Characterized by their deep, exposed front, adding a distinct aesthetic and increased capacity.
    • Undermount sinks: Installed beneath the countertop, creating a seamless look and making countertop cleaning easier.
    • Top-mount sinks (Drop-in sinks): Installed from above, with a rim that rests on the countertop. They are generally easier and less expensive to install.
  • Bathroom Sinks: Primarily used for personal hygiene, bathroom sinks come in a variety of styles and sizes to fit different bathroom layouts. Common types include:

    • Pedestal sinks: A classic choice, featuring a sink basin supported by a narrow pedestal, ideal for smaller bathrooms.
    • Wall-mounted sinks: Attached directly to the wall, saving floor space and offering a minimalist look.
    • Console sinks: Similar to wall-mounted sinks but often supported by legs, providing a bit more stability and a decorative element.
    • Vanity sinks: Integrated into a bathroom vanity cabinet, offering storage space and a cohesive look. These can be top-mount, undermount, or vessel sinks.
    • Vessel sinks: Sitting on top of the countertop, these are a popular contemporary choice, adding a sculptural element to the bathroom.
  • Utility Sinks (Laundry Sinks): Found in laundry rooms, garages, or basements, these are typically deep and durable, designed for tasks like hand-washing clothes, cleaning muddy boots, or filling large containers.

Materials and Considerations for Sinks

The material of a sink significantly impacts its durability, aesthetics, and maintenance requirements. Common materials include:

  • Stainless steel: Durable, heat-resistant, and relatively affordable, often found in kitchens. It can be prone to scratches and water spots.
  • Porcelain/Ceramic: A classic choice for bathrooms, offering a smooth, non-porous surface that is easy to clean and resistant to stains. It can chip or crack if subjected to heavy impact.
  • Granite composite: A blend of granite dust and acrylic resins, offering exceptional durability, scratch resistance, and a wide range of colors.
  • Natural stone (e.g., marble, quartz): Luxurious and aesthetically pleasing, but can be porous and require more specialized sealing and cleaning.
  • Cast iron (enameled): Extremely durable and resistant to heat and stains, often found in farmhouse sinks. The enamel coating can chip.

When selecting a sink, consider the intended use, the available space, the countertop material, and the overall design aesthetic of the room. Proper installation and regular cleaning are essential for maintaining the longevity and functionality of any sink.

2. The Toilet: The Cornerstone of Sanitation

The toilet is a non-negotiable fixture in any modern home, responsible for the safe and hygienic disposal of human waste. It’s a complex piece of engineering that utilizes water to flush waste away into the sewage system. The core components of a toilet include the bowl, the tank (which stores water for flushing), the flush mechanism, and the seat.

Types of Toilets: Efficiency and Design

Toilets have evolved considerably in terms of water efficiency and design.

  • Gravity-flush toilets: The most common type, relying on gravity to pull water from the tank into the bowl for flushing.
  • Low-flow toilets: Designed to use significantly less water per flush (typically 1.6 gallons or less), meeting modern environmental standards and saving water.
  • Dual-flush toilets: Offer two flushing options – a partial flush for liquid waste and a full flush for solid waste – further enhancing water conservation.
  • Pressure-assisted toilets: Utilize compressed air to create a more powerful flush, often found in commercial settings or for homes with challenging drainage systems.
  • One-piece toilets: The tank and bowl are manufactured as a single unit, offering a sleeker look and easier cleaning as there are fewer crevices for dirt to accumulate.
  • Two-piece toilets: The tank and bowl are separate components, typically bolted together. These are generally more affordable and easier to transport and install.
  • Wall-hung toilets: Mounted directly to the wall, with the tank concealed within the wall cavity. They save floor space and create a minimalist, modern aesthetic.

Toilet Materials and Maintenance

The vast majority of toilets are made from vitreous china, a durable and non-porous ceramic material that is easy to clean and resistant to staining. Regular cleaning of the toilet bowl, tank, and exterior is crucial for hygiene. Checking the flush mechanism periodically for leaks or malfunctions is also important. A dripping toilet can waste a significant amount of water over time.

3. The Shower/Bathtub: Personal Cleansing and Relaxation

The shower and bathtub are dedicated fixtures for personal hygiene and relaxation, offering a more immersive cleaning experience than a sink. While distinct in their design, they often share the same plumbing supply lines and drainage systems.

The Shower: Efficiency and Invigoration

Showers provide a quick and efficient way to cleanse the body. They consist of a showerhead that dispenses water, a drain in the floor, and typically an enclosure to contain the water.

  • Standard Shower: A common setup with a showerhead mounted on the wall.
  • Walk-in Shower: A doorless shower stall, often preferred for accessibility and a modern look.
  • Shower/Tub Combo: Combines the functionality of a bathtub with an overhead showerhead, offering versatility.

Shower systems can range from simple single-head setups to luxurious multi-head systems with features like body jets and rainfall showerheads. Material considerations for shower bases and walls include acrylic, fiberglass, tile, and solid stone.

The Bathtub: Relaxation and Rejuvenation

Bathtubs offer a more leisurely and relaxing bathing experience. They are essentially large basins designed to hold water for soaking.

  • Alcove Bathtubs: Designed to fit into a three-walled recess, often with a showerhead above.
  • Freestanding Bathtubs: Stand-alone fixtures that can be placed anywhere in a bathroom, making a strong design statement.
  • Drop-in Bathtubs: Installed into a surrounding deck or platform.
  • Undermount Bathtubs: Installed beneath a countertop, similar to undermount sinks.

Bathtub materials include acrylic, fiberglass, cast iron (often enameled), and cultured marble. Features like whirlpool jets and air jets can turn a standard bathtub into a therapeutic spa experience.

Regular cleaning of showerheads, drains, and the tub basin is essential to prevent mold, mildew, and mineral buildup. Ensuring proper drainage is also critical to avoid water accumulation.

4. The Faucet: The Control Center for Water Flow

While not a fixture in the same sense as a sink or toilet, the faucet is the indispensable control mechanism for all water-dispensing fixtures. It’s the device that allows us to turn water on and off, regulate its temperature, and control its flow rate. Faucets are found on sinks, bathtubs, showers, and even bidets.

Types of Faucets: Functionality and Style

Faucets come in a vast array of designs and mechanisms to suit different applications and aesthetic preferences.

  • Compression faucets: An older, traditional design that uses rubber washers to control water flow. They are generally inexpensive but can be prone to leaks over time.
  • Cartridge faucets: Use a movable stem cartridge to control water flow. They are more durable and easier to repair than compression faucets.
  • Ball faucets: Feature a single handle that moves over a rounded cap and contains a slotted metal ball that controls water flow and temperature. Common in kitchens.
  • Ceramic disc faucets: Use two ceramic discs that slide against each other to control water flow. They are highly durable, leak-resistant, and offer smooth handle operation.
  • Touchless (sensor) faucets: Activated by a motion sensor, offering hands-free operation for increased hygiene and convenience. Commonly found in kitchens and commercial restrooms.

Faucet Finishes and Considerations

The finish of a faucet can significantly impact its appearance and durability. Popular finishes include:

  • Chrome: Durable, easy to clean, and a classic choice for many bathrooms and kitchens.
  • Brushed nickel: Offers a softer, warmer look than chrome and is more resistant to water spots and fingerprints.
  • Bronze (oil-rubbed, Venetian): Provides a more traditional or rustic aesthetic.
  • Matte black: A popular contemporary choice, offering a bold and modern look.
  • Stainless steel: Durable and resistant to corrosion, often matching other stainless steel appliances.

When choosing a faucet, consider the type of fixture it will be used with, the water pressure in your home, and the desired style and finish. Regular maintenance, such as cleaning aerators and checking for drips, ensures optimal performance.

5. The Water Heater: The Provider of Hot Water

While often considered an appliance, the water heater is an integral part of the plumbing system, directly enabling the functionality of many plumbing fixtures by providing heated water. Without a water heater, the use of showers, bathtubs, and kitchen sinks for many tasks would be severely limited.

Types of Water Heaters: Energy Efficiency and Capacity

Water heaters vary significantly in their technology, energy source, and capacity.

  • Storage tank water heaters: The most common type, featuring an insulated tank that stores and heats a large volume of water. They are typically powered by electricity, natural gas, propane, or oil.
  • Tankless (on-demand) water heaters: Heat water as it flows through the unit, providing an endless supply of hot water without the need for a storage tank. They are more energy-efficient but can have a higher upfront cost. They can be powered by electricity or gas.
  • Heat pump water heaters (hybrid water heaters): Use electricity to move heat from the surrounding air into the water tank, making them highly energy-efficient.
  • Solar water heaters: Utilize solar energy to preheat water, with a backup conventional water heater for cloudy days or high demand.

Water Heater Considerations

Key considerations when choosing a water heater include:

  • Fuel source: Availability and cost of electricity, natural gas, or propane in your area.
  • Capacity: The size of the storage tank or the flow rate required to meet your household’s hot water demands.
  • Energy efficiency: Look for ENERGY STAR certified models to save on utility bills.
  • Installation and maintenance: Proper installation is crucial for safety and efficiency. Regular maintenance, such as flushing the tank to remove sediment, can prolong its lifespan.

The water heater is a critical component that directly impacts the comfort and usability of your home. Regular checks for leaks and proper maintenance are essential to ensure its safe and efficient operation.

How does a toilet function as a core plumbing fixture?

A toilet serves as a critical component of a home’s sanitation system, designed to efficiently remove human waste using water. Its operation involves a two-part process: filling and flushing. When water is released from the tank, it creates a siphoning action that pulls waste from the bowl down into the drainage pipes, carrying it away from the living space.

The flushing mechanism is controlled by the tank, which holds a reserve of water. When the flush handle is activated, a flapper valve opens, allowing water to flow rapidly into the bowl. Once the tank empties, the flapper closes, and a refill valve automatically replenishes the tank with fresh water, preparing it for the next use. This cycle is essential for maintaining hygiene and preventing odor buildup.

What are some common issues associated with core plumbing fixtures?

Common issues associated with core plumbing fixtures can range from minor inconveniences to significant problems. Leaks are perhaps the most frequent, occurring at faucets, showerheads, toilet bases, or connections to the water supply lines. Clogs are another prevalent concern, particularly in toilets and sinks, where accumulated debris can obstruct water flow.

Other common problems include low water pressure, inconsistent water temperature in showers and sinks, and running toilets that waste significant amounts of water. These issues can stem from various causes, including worn-out seals, sediment buildup in pipes, faulty valves, or problems with the overall water pressure to the house. Addressing these problems promptly is essential to prevent further damage and maintain the efficiency of the plumbing system.
